The Catrina is a very popular symbol of the Day of the Dead that represents death. She dresses in a very elegant way, with a long dress and a wide hat decorated with flowers or feathers. The Catrín wears a formal suit and is the eternal lover of the Catrina and her party partner in life and in death. Faces are adorned with colorful makeup to resemble a skeleton.
